Output 313528404057318029477ffafc7e1a0189675ae194cbefb001243f9309aefcc9:1

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 d6735535d43e1130451ac68600258ef39d5ee1d6
address
bc1q6ee42dw58cgnq3g6c6rqqfvw7ww4acwkpw6s3x
transaction
313528404057318029477ffafc7e1a0189675ae194cbefb001243f9309aefcc9
confirmations
165454
spent
true